Situated in central Georgia's Laurens County, Dublin rests on Coastal Plain sediments that generally produce low radon concentrations. The community's mix of older homes and newer construction typically features crawl space foundations common to the region. Since comprehensive radon data is not yet available for Dublin, local residents should conduct professional testing to determine their home's specific radon levels.

Laurens County Radon Profile

Laurens County is classified as EPA Radon Zone 3, the lowest predicted-risk tier, with modeled indoor screening averages below 2 pCi/L. User-submitted readings are still sparse within Laurens County itself, so the nearby measurements shown on this page provide the closest real-world picture of local radon conditions. Radon is the second leading cause of lung cancer in the United States, and a short-term test is the only way to confirm a specific home's level in Laurens County.

Radon FAQ for Dublin, GA

What EPA Radon Zone is Dublin in?
Dublin and the 31021 zip code are in Laurens County, which has an EPA assigned Radon Zone of 3. A zone of 3 predicts an average indoor radon screening level less than 2 pCi/L.

EPA radon zones are county-level predictions of radon potential, so the EPA recommends testing every individual home regardless of its zone, since levels vary from house to house.
How much does radon mitigation cost in Dublin?
Radon mitigation in Dublin typically costs between $800 and $2,000. Most homes with standard basements can be mitigated with a sub-slab depressurization system in the $1,000–$1,500 range. Factors that can increase cost include complex foundations, crawl spaces, or very high radon levels.
Should I test for radon if I'm buying a home in Dublin?
Yes. Radon testing should be part of every home purchase. A short-term radon test is typically included as part of the home inspection process and costs $150–$250. If elevated levels are found, you can negotiate mitigation as part of the sale.
